[quote="ArthurClues"]
Who else would he pick though Clueso? He tried Lumb who went pop. Edgell is game but not a big lad, and is gonna get dominated in the tackle and in D potentially more than Roberts, who at least has some size. Ned McCormack could play wing but probably isn't quite quick enough (looked like he got chased down a bit against Luke Briscoe at one point against Donny..), and again is learning his trade in RL. Jack Smith I think has been injured. RS brought in Matty Russell who went pop within 30 minutes. What do you want him to do?

Roberts looks miles better at centre where he's not so exposed under the high bomb, but RS has to pick the least bad side he can - like Frawley in for Sinfield, which for Saints I actually think was the right selection because of his D. Hurrell ran at him all night, if they'd have done the same on Sinfield he'd have really, really struggled. If Jack had missed 12-15 tackles and let Hurrell run over him several times, everyone on here would be criticising Smith to high heaven for exposing the young lad too early, he literally can't win.

The only thing that can protect Smith is winning games, as soon as you're losing too much then the knives come out and people vent their frustrations and blame. We should be winning 3/4 of the next fixtures and putting better performances in.

Exeter Rhino wrote:I agree with Jim that most of the errors are not directly about any style the team are being asked to play. We are making these consistently through games, including spells when the pressure is off. Of course when we have been under the pump for extended periods of time the incidence of errors and penalties increases.

Re: the forwards, they need to step up collectively. Individually few have done much of merit this season. Oledski needs to be more aggressive, run hard more often, and not simply look to go to ground quickly to win a quick PTB on every tackle.

Lisone might be a Matt Adamson style fans favourite but he's the first one that I would show the door to. His discipline is atrocious for a player who spends so little time on the field. We are not getting value for our quota spot here. His 5 minute cameos might work against poorer sides but he lacks the size and impact to be a competition leading player. He might be worth it if the rest of the forwards are laying some sort of platform but that's not happening.

McDonnell was a strong player last season but he seems to have faded a lot. Reading Redvee (I know!), they seem to regard him as a bit of a grub and can't understand why Leeds put so much stock in him. I don't agree with all of that, but he does seem to be really struggling this season. Cameron Smith is another who looks really out of sorts. Goudemand looks pretty anonymous. Might as well give Donaldson another run out...

Agree - with McDonnell the problem is, like with Holroyd, they both do a ton of work in D which gasses them. They're having to do this work because players around them aren't - I just think it makes both players look worse than they actually are. Both would look way better playing with 2 really high quality forwards to take some pressure off.

Lisone is devastating on his day, but for an experienced player he doesn't control it well enough. Giving away penalties when you're in possession is mindless. Again, he only works well in a team that is already dominant, and he can come in and twist the knife. He doesn't have the control to work well in a team under pressure.

KaeruJim wrote:Again disagree that style = errors. I think people are finding any way to attribute blame to RS when we're talking like this frankly.

There is plenty to criticise about his approach but the errors are individual players lacking quality and/or concentration and discipline in key moments. We will retain the errors unless we switch out some repeat offenders.

I agree with you mostly over the analysis on the props. Holroyd needs an injury-free run and a real pre-season, but he does defend aggressively and puts himself about in the middle. Mik is fine, he's a good player. We fall off very quickly beyond those two though - Lisone is one with errors/sloppiness to his play, and Sangare doesn't run his weight.

Part of the problem though is the lightweight-ish back row. The only back rower who can bend the line is probably Smith, but I think we need another second row who is hard to handle. Personally I think McDonnell is our best grafter/dirty work player but all the other pack members should be awkward to defend against if we want more domination in centre field.

Re-signing Bentley and Donaldson (who to be fair is more here for morale than actually playing at this stage), and signing Goudemand just exacerbates the problems we have in the pack. We do have some better prospects coming through the academy but they could be a couple of years off realistically.
